St. Zygmunt Szczęsny Feliński
Founder of the Franciscan Sisters of the Family of Mary
Life and historical setting
Zygmunt Szczęsny Feliński (1822–1895) is remembered in the Church as founder of the Franciscan Sisters of the Family of Mary. The supplied Catholic source associates this life with Voiutyn.
Documented offices and forms of service associated with Zygmunt Szczęsny Feliński include Roman Catholic Archbishop of Warsaw, titular archbishop, Catholic priest. The religious family connected with this vocation is Franciscan.
